And the quick hash And the mad dash. The bright night With the nerves tight. The plane hop With the brief stop. The lamp tan In a short span. The Big Shot In a good spot. And the brain strain The heart pain. And the cat naps Till the spring snaps - And the fun's done!" Sound familiar? But wait - this poem was actually published in 'The Saturday Evening Post' in 1949, under the title, "Time of the Mad Atom." Seems that people were as rushed then as they are now!
